Justice League, which first appeared in 1960, featured Superman, Batman, Wonder Woman, Flash, Green Lantern, Aquaman, and the Martian Manhunter. There were a lot of additions in the subsequent editions. Here's a list of Justice League members with their unique powers.
Founding Members
Member Name Real Name Description Powers and Abilities
Superman Kal-El/Clark Kent Born on a distant planet Krypton, he was raised as Clark Kent on planet Earth after he was sent here during the destruction of Krypton.
  • Strongest man on earth
  • Can fly at unmatchable speeds
  • Shoots heat beams from his eyes
  • Shoots frost from his mouth
Batman Bruce Wayne Witnessed a tragic childhood after his parents were murdered in front of him. This motivates him to dedicate his life to fight crime. Goes through rigorous training to be mentally and physically agile.
  • No superpowers
  • Highly developed detective skills
  • Massive resources
  • Unmatched dedication
Wonder Woman Diana Prince / Princess Diana Comes from the Amazons, an all-female society that resides on the island nation of Themyscira (Paradise Island). When Captain Steve Trevor's plane crashed on the island, he is nursed and taken care of by Diana. The Amazon sisters decide who will take Trevor back to the man's world by a competition, which Diana wins.
  • Super-strength
  • Very high mental and physical abilities
  • Resistance to fire
  • Telescopic vision and super hearing
  • Flight
Flash Barry Allen Working as a forensic scientist, Barry Allen got his powers when a lightning bolt hit his lab, shattering the chemical containers resulting in them spilling all over Barry.
  • Ability to run faster than light
  • Time-traveling ability
  • Can move through dimensions by vibrating his molecules
Green Lantern Hal Jordan The power ring chooses Hal Jordan as a member of the Green Lantern Corps. after a dying alien, Abir Sur, crash-lands his ship on earth.
  • Flight
  • Ability to create and control constructs through his mind
Aquaman Orin / Arthur Curry Found by a lighthouse keeper as a child, who named Arthur Curry after himself. He raises him and teaches him to use his powers to fight crime.
  • Ability to communicate with marine life telepathically
  • Super-speed
  • Super-strength
Martian Manhunter J'onn J'onzz Coming from the planet Mars, he is a green-skinned humanoid, and the last surviving member of his race. He gets pulled on planet Earth by a teleportation beam constructed by Dr. Saul Erdel in an attempt to communicate with the Martians.
  • Flight
  • Super-strength
  • Shape-shifting
  • Telepathy
  • Invisibility
Other Members
Member Name Powers and Abilities
Atom
  • Size-alteration to subatomic level without losing his natural strength
Atom Smasher
  • Manipulation of strength and density
Aztek
  • Flight
  • Infra-red and X-Ray vision
  • Invisibility
  • Intangibility
  • Density manipulation
Black Canary
  • An expert in judo
  • Acting and impersonation
  • Sonic scream
Blue Devil
  • Superhuman strength
  • Ability to find demons on Earth
Booster Gold
  • Excellent athlete
  • Futuristic equipment that produce force blasts
Captain Atom
  • Can release massive amounts of energy
Captain Marvel
  • On saying the magic word 'Shazam', he is granted: the wisdom of Solomon, the strength of Hercules, the stamina of Atlas, the power of Zeus, the courage of Achilles, the speed of Mercury
Creeper
  • Extreme agility and stamina
Cyborg
  • Superhuman strength
  • Very high intelligence
  • Excellent hand-to-hand fighter
Deadman
  • Invisibility
  • Peak level athleticism
  • Flight
Elongated Man
  • Ability to stretch his body to superhuman lengths, shapes, and sizes
Etrigan
  • Extremely powerful
  • Enhanced senses
  • Super-speed
  • Agility
  • Telepathy
  • Energy blasts
  • Fangs and claws
Firestorm
  • Can change the atomic structure of an object (inorganic matter)
Green Arrow
  • Highly skilled archer
  • Proficient in martial arts
Gypsy
  • Illusion casting (can blend herself in the background)
Hawkman
  • Flight
  • Super-strength
  • Enhanced vision and hearing
  • Ability to summon birds telepathically
Hawkwoman
  • Enhanced strength and speed
  • Energy weaponry
Hourman
  • Manipulation of space-time
  • Durability
  • Strength
Huntress
  • Excellent athlete
  • Highly skilled hand-to-hand fighter
Ice
  • Snow control and manipulation
  • Snow creation
  • Snow/ice magic
  • Blizzard creation
  • Snowstorm creation
Metamorpho
  • Manipulation of body parts
Obsidian
  • Ability to merge his body with his own shadow
  • Ability to enlarge himself as a shadow
Orion
  • Immortality
  • Speed
  • Endurance
  • Self-healing at a superhuman rate
Plastic Man
  • Ability to stretch his body in any shape
Ray
  • Light generation
  • Change to energy form
  • Flight
Red Tornado
  • Ability to manipulate air and wind
  • Speed
  • Self-repair
Rocket Red
  • Invulnerability
  • Flight
  • Super-strength
  • Energy blasts
Starman
  • Super-strength
  • Flight
  • Energy projection
Steel
  • Superhuman strength
Supergirl
  • Superhuman strength
  • Speed
  • Flight
Vibe
  • Ability to manipulate sonic vibration
  • Seismic powers
  • Excellent break-dancer
Vixen
  • Can mimic the abilities of any animal
  • Self-healing at a superhuman rate
Zatanna
  • Highly skilled user of magic
